Kuala Lumpur's Aspirations To Become A Global, Livable City

Kuala Lumpur has seen immense development in her more than 160-year history. Today, in the city's quest to become a global, livable city, KL must balance rapid urbanisation with preserving her heritage and culture, while enhancing real estate value for residents and investors alike.
